- 1.Quantitative Aptitude
Pipe A fills a tank in 10 hours and pipe B in 8 hours. If both are opened together, how long to fill the tank?
- 2.Quantitative Aptitude
Find the compound interest on £10,000 at 10% per annum compounded annually for 2 years.
- 3.Quantitative Aptitude
A vehicle covers 292 km in 4 hours. Find its average speed.
- 4.Quantitative Aptitude
An item is bought for £800 and sold for £1,000. Find the profit percentage.
- 5.Quantitative Aptitude
In how many ways can 3 objects be chosen from 5 distinct objects? (Find ⁿᴄᵣ for n = 5, r = 3.)
- 6.Quantitative Aptitude
Find the compound interest on £19,000 at 10% per annum compounded annually for 3 years.
- 7.Quantitative Aptitude
In how many ways can 3 objects be arranged out of 6 distinct objects? (Find ⁿᴘᵣ for n = 6, r = 3.)
- 8.Quantitative Aptitude
Two varieties costing £27 and £66 per kg are mixed to give a mixture worth £35 per kg. Find the mixing ratio.
- 9.Quantitative Aptitude
Two fair dice are rolled. What is the probability that the sum of the numbers is 7?
- 10.Quantitative Aptitude
Find the average of these 10 numbers: 58, 27, 73, 29, 54, 51, 20, 29, 81, 60.
- 11.Quantitative Aptitude
A invests £3,000 and B invests £3,000 for the same period. If the total profit is £33,000, find A's share.
- 12.Quantitative Aptitude
An item is bought for £600 and sold for £660. Find the profit percentage.
- 13.Quantitative Aptitude
A value changes from 600 to 480. Find the percentage decrease.
- 14.Quantitative Aptitude
An item is bought for £500 and sold for £750. Find the profit percentage.
- 15.Quantitative Aptitude
Find the simple interest on £30,000 at 10% per annum for 2 year(s).
